Legally, the law (from memory, I think it's s.12 Allotments Act 1950) appears to state that as long as your chickens do not cause any nuisance (i.e. noise, smells, rats etc) then you cannot be prevented from keeping them irrespective of anything in the lease for your council house. WebIn a residential area, Council limits each household to two dogs. The Dog Act of 1976 provides that owners need to ensure that their dog: Wears a collar, is microchipped (with current owner details) and the Council’s registration tag is attached when in a public place. Can be confined to the premises where it lives. WebRules for keeping pets in a council home.
